Transaction ed84381740a976eb4e09ec6de47d16b985a74745fcfd79635c98dfbd2d80ba11
1 Input
1 Output
-
ed84381740a976eb4e09ec6de47d16b985a74745fcfd79635c98dfbd2d80ba11:0
- value
- 2292172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c068113a00fc67e6d7fcb09a510df06ffbd8f835 OP_EQUAL
- address
- 3KENL6bmRX7H33AjpCHN6YxUW4LoUgPsHa